Arriving at Varna Airport
If you have not made arrangements for somebody to meet you ( most of the times we meet our clients and drive them to their hotel), before you get into a taxi, make sure that the “meter” is on and that the driver has quoted to you the cost, otherwise you can be overcharged (most taxi drivers charge non-Bulgarians double).

Moving around:
Most shops, hotels and restaurants, with the exception of some major hotels, still do not accept travellers' checks or credit cards. Bulgaria is still largely a cash economy, so visitors will need a reasonable amount of Bulgarian Leva. It is strongly recommended that foreign currency (either Euro, US Dollars or Pounds) is exchanged only at banks or licensed exchange bureaus, as changing money in the street may result in fraud. In addition ATM cash machines are increasing in numbers in the main towns and resorts, allowing Leva to be drawn with all major debit/credit cards.
